Dorien Frederick Cannon was born in Oak Lawn, Illinois, on June 6, 2003, to Sharron Jackson and DeAndre Cannon. He lived a life full of love, energy, enthusiasm, and an indomitable spirit that touched everyone who had the privilege of knowing him. He passed away April 22, 2026.Visitation is 1:00 to 2:00 p.m. Monday, May 11, in the Horizon Room at Trimble Funeral Home at Trimble Pointe, 701 12th Street, Moline, immediately followed by a hospitality gathering from 2:00 to 4:00 p.m. at CityView Celebrations at Trimble Pointe. Memorials may be made to the family.Dorien attended United Township High School in Moline, Illinois, where he proudly graduated. He later worked at Taco Bell, where he truly enjoyed his job and built meaningful friendships with his coworkers, who became like family to him.Dorien was known for his bright personality, kind heart, and the joy he brought to those around him. He carried himself with strength and determination, always facing life with courage and a smile. In his free time, he enjoyed going on walks, playing video games, and playing and goofing off with his siblings.He deeply cherished his family and friends, and the bonds he created will never be broken. His love was genuine, and his loyalty was unwavering. Those who knew him will remember his sense of humor, his warmth, and the happiness he shared.Dorien Frederick Cannon leaves to cherish his memory his loving parents, Sharron Jackson and DeAndre Cannon; his siblings, De’Seandrea Cannon, Makalia Cannon, Raahsaan Brown, Jamel Kellogg, Javante Traylor, Davante Jackson, DeAndre Cannon Jr., Deangelo Cannon, Jaylynn Cannon, and Deanna Cannon; his nieces and nephews, Da’shaya, Lyrik, Davante Jr., Da’Money, Jayla, Jamel, Ramiah Raahsaan III, and Raahmeir; his grandparents, Carmelita Jackson Williams, Ladell Williams, and Steven Stansbury; his aunts and uncles, Shanta Jackson Walker, Rosa Beckon, Ira L. Williams, Rocky Cannon, Lawrence Cannon; along with a host of extended family members and dear friends.He was preceded in death by his grandmother, Theresa Cannon; his sister, Miracle Jackson; and his brother, Desean Cannon.Though his time with us was far too short, Dorien’s legacy of love, strength, and resilience will live on forever in the hearts of those who loved him.“Don’t say goodbye to me, say see you later”The family invites friends to share stories and condolences at TrimbleFuneralHomes.com.
